package blackbox
import (
"context"
"fmt"
"github.com/ossrs/go-oryx-lib/errors"
"github.com/ossrs/go-oryx-lib/logger"
"math/rand"
"os"
"path"
"sync"
"testing"
"time"
)
func TestFast_RtmpPublish_DvrFlv_Basic(t *testing.T) {
// This case is run in parallel.
t.Parallel()
// Setup the max timeout for this case.
ctx, cancel := context.WithTimeout(logger.WithContext(context.Background()), time.Duration(*srsTimeout)*time.Millisecond)
defer cancel()
// Check a set of errors.
var r0, r1, r2, r3, r4, r5, r6 error
defer func(ctx context.Context) {
if err := filterTestError(ctx.Err(), r0, r1, r2, r3, r4, r5, r6); err != nil {
t.Errorf("Fail for err %+v", err)
} else {
logger.Tf(ctx, "test done with err %+v", err)
}
}(ctx)
var wg sync.WaitGroup
defer wg.Wait()
// Start hooks service.
hooks := NewHooksService()
wg.Add(1)
go func() {
defer wg.Done()
r6 = hooks.Run(ctx, cancel)
}()
// Start SRS server and wait for it to be ready.
svr := NewSRSServer(func(v *srsServer) {
v.envs = []string{
"SRS_VHOST_DVR_ENABLED=on",
"SRS_VHOST_DVR_DVR_PLAN=session",
"SRS_VHOST_DVR_DVR_PATH=./objs/nginx/html/[app]/[stream].[timestamp].flv",
fmt.Sprintf("SRS_VHOST_DVR_DVR_DURATION=%v", *srsFFprobeDuration),
"SRS_VHOST_HTTP_HOOKS_ENABLED=on",
fmt.Sprintf("SRS_VHOST_HTTP_HOOKS_ON_DVR=http://localhost:%v/api/v1/dvrs", hooks.HooksAPI()),
}
})
wg.Add(1)
go func() {
defer wg.Done()
<-hooks.ReadyCtx().Done()
r0 = svr.Run(ctx, cancel)
}()
// Start FFmpeg to publish stream.
duration := time.Duration(*srsFFprobeDuration) * time.Millisecond
streamID := fmt.Sprintf("stream-%v-%v", os.Getpid(), rand.Int())
streamURL := fmt.Sprintf("rtmp://localhost:%v/live/%v", svr.RTMPPort(), streamID)
ffmpeg := NewFFmpeg(func(v *ffmpegClient) {
// When process quit, still keep case to run.
v.cancelCaseWhenQuit, v.ffmpegDuration = false, duration
v.args = []string{
"-stream_loop", "-1", "-re", "-i", *srsPublishAvatar, "-c", "copy", "-f", "flv", streamURL,
}
})
wg.Add(1)
go func() {
defer wg.Done()
<-svr.ReadyCtx().Done()
r1 = ffmpeg.Run(ctx, cancel)
}()
// Start FFprobe to detect and verify stream.
ffprobe := NewFFprobe(func(v *ffprobeClient) {
v.dvrByFFmpeg, v.streamURL = false, streamURL
v.duration, v.timeout = duration, time.Duration(*srsFFprobeTimeout)*time.Millisecond
wg.Add(1)
go func() {
defer wg.Done()
for evt := range hooks.HooksEvents() {
if onDvrEvt, ok := evt.(*HooksEventOnDvr); ok {
fp := path.Join(svr.WorkDir(), onDvrEvt.File)
logger.Tf(ctx, "FFprobe: Set the dvrFile=%v from callback", fp)
v.dvrFile = fp
}
}
}()
})
wg.Add(1)
go func() {
defer wg.Done()
<-svr.ReadyCtx().Done()
r2 = ffprobe.Run(ctx, cancel)
}()
// Fast quit for probe done.
select {
case <-ctx.Done():
case <-ffprobe.ProbeDoneCtx().Done():
defer cancel()
str, m := ffprobe.Result()
if len(m.Streams) != 2 {
r3 = errors.Errorf("invalid streams=%v, %v, %v", len(m.Streams), m.String(), str)
}
if ts := 90; m.Format.ProbeScore < ts {
r4 = errors.Errorf("low score=%v < %v, %v, %v", m.Format.ProbeScore, ts, m.String(), str)
}
if dv := m.Duration(); dv < duration/2 {
r5 = errors.Errorf("short duration=%v < %v, %v, %v", dv, duration/2, m.String(), str)
}
}
}
